Context Readings
Paul's Gospel And The Resurrection Of Christ
4 he was buried, he was raised on the third day according to the Scriptures and is still alive! 5 and he was seen by Cephas, and then by the Twelve. 6 After that, he was seen by more than 500 brothers at one time, most of whom are still alive, though some have died.
